A new drama showcasing singer-actress Suzy's mesmerizing transformation is set to drop this year, and it's already drawing major buzz.
On the 22nd, Disney+'s lineup video unveiled first-look scenes from the Disney+ original series Portraits of Delusion starring Suzy.
Set in 1935 Gyeongseong (old Seoul), Portraits of Delusion follows painter Yoon I-ho (played by Kim Seon-ho), who is commissioned to paint the portrait of Song Jeong-hwa (played by Suzy) — a captivating woman who's also a vampire and has stayed hidden from the world for over half a century. As he approaches her, he begins to uncover her haunting secret.
After the still cuts and teaser clips dropped, online communities exploded with debate over Suzy's styling. While the original webtoon features a 2:8 side part, the drama switches it up with a bob and a 5:5 center part for a fresh, contrasting vibe.
Reactions were split: some praised, saying, "Even that old-fashioned bob looks gorgeous on Suzy" and "It's better than the original," while others pushed back with "It feels too old," "It's tacky," and "Was this really the best they could do?"
Based on the webtoon of the same name, Portraits of Delusion is slated to premiere this year, promising a new side of Suzy and her hypnotic beauty.
